Wilderness First Aid (WFA) for scouting is a set of essential skills and knowledge to handle medical emergencies in outdoor settings where professional help may be delayed. It emphasizes the basics of injury prevention, recognition of common illnesses, and immediate care techniques for a wide range of situations. Key topics include:

  1. Assessment: How to assess the environment and the injured or ill person.
  2. Treatment: Techniques like splinting, wound care, CPR, and managing hypothermia or heat-related illnesses.
  3. Communication: How to effectively communicate with team members and get help.
  4. Self-care and safety: Ensuring safety for both the rescuer and the patient.

In scouting, these skills are vital for outdoor adventures, ensuring scouts are equipped to handle emergencies until help arrives.
